Even family members who aren't huge fans of butterscotch kept asking for butterscotch lattes.We bought several of the Amoretti syrups, and I’ll include all of them in this review. We’ve tried pretty much all of the major brands, including Torani, Da Vinci, and Monin. This is our favorite brand. In general, the Amoretti syrups are richer and have more complex flavor profiles. They are also thicker, which makes them more versatile because they can be used for drizzling or dipping or even baking etc, as opposed to most other brands that are meant only for adding to drinks.We like some flavors more than others. I’ll include all of the flavors we’ve tried. Our favorite flavors are amaretto and butterscotch (our family and guests have gone through two thirds of a bottle in only 2 weeks). Our least favorite flavors are hazelnut (it’s more sweet than nutty, and we prefer a more nutty flavor) and caramel (we definitely won’t buy caramel again but will definitely try cajeta and dulce de leche).Dark chocolate. I was pleasantly surprised at how nice this chocolate syrup is. It is NOT cloying (overly sweet), and it is not creamy (they do have a milk chocolate syrup for those who prefer a creamy chocolate). This tastes like real cocoa - like a dark chocolate bar that’s been melted into a syrup. We usually buy the Ghirardelli dark chocolate syrup, but we will be switching to this syrup. It is the perfect syrup to drizzle over ice cream or make a mocha latte.Vanilla bean. This is good. Definitely better than Torani. What I like about this syrup is that they went in the right direction with more vanilla, which means you don’t have to put as much in your coffee. It’s still not as good as homemade vanilla syrup, but I also can’t keep homemade vanilla syrup in the fridge for very long. I’ll try their other vanilla syrup (which is three times the price of this one) and see if it’s closer to my homemade version. That said, this is definitely the best vanilla syrup I’ve ever purchased.Caramel. This is our absolute least favorite of all of the flavors we have tried so far. The flavor profile is very simple. I wish I had seen the dulce de leche or cajeta flavors before I ordered the caramel. We will never use this syrup, but guests will often ask for caramel when we make espresso drinks for dinner parties, weekend brunches, etc.Hazelnut. This is just ok. It did not have enough nuttiness for our taste. We generally use hazelnut syrups very often, so we were very surprised. We all felt that the sweetness overpowered the nuttiness. I will likely send an email asking if they have other hazelnut products that we might like better for our coffee drinks because we are very impressed with the quality of the syrups - just not the flavor profiles of caramel or hazelnut. But hey, four out of six flavors were amazing.Amaretto. Wow. Just wow. This actually tastes like amaretto. This is an absolutely fantastic syrup. The quality of this particular syrup makes me want to try all of their nonalcoholic liqueur syrups. Jamaican rum will be up next!Butterscotch. This is the family favorite. Every single family member who was here over the holidays loved this butterscotch in their espresso drinks. We’ve tried other butterscotch syrups in the past, and nobody wanted to drink them. I bought this on a whim because I love butterscotch, and it was a real surprise hit. I thought it would be our least favorite, but it’s #1. Everyone was putting this in their lattes and drizzling it over ice cream and brownies.Flavors we plan to try next: cinnamon, coconut, Jamaican rum, cajeta, and dulce de leche. If you're like me, you think that butterscotch is one of the most underrated flavors of all time. Amazing to me that it's not in every coffee shop in the world. I use it a lot with my cold brews, but it's also great in hot chocolate. One thing about this particular brand that actually speaks to its quality is that it is very thick and can take some extra stirring to dissolve. If this is an issue for you, go with the Torani brand. The Torani flavor isn't quite as rich and complex, but it does dissolve much easier.
